Haugenstua Station
Haugenstua Station is a railway station on the Trunk Line located in the Haugenstua neighborhood of Oslo, Norway. Situated 12.09 kilometers from Oslo Central Station, it consists of two side platforms along a double tracked line and a disused station building.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Grorud Station
Railway station
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Grorud Station is a railway station on the Trunk Line located in the Grorud borough of Oslo, Norway. Situated 10.50 kilometers from Oslo Central Station, it consists of three tracks with a side platforms and an island platform. Grorud Station is situated 1¼ km west of Haugenstua Station.

Høybråten
Suburb
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.5.
Høybråten is a residential area in the north-eastern part of Norway's capital Oslo. Høybråten has its own church, schools and railway station. As of 2024, the estimated population is 8076.
Furuset
Suburb
Photo: Helge Høifødt,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Furuset is residential and suburban area, situated in the northeast of Oslo, Norway. It was a separate borough of Oslo up to January 1, 2004, when it became part of the new borough of Alna.
